Ethical issues in empirical studies of software engineering

被引:67
|
作者
Singer, J [1 ]
Vinson, NG [1 ]
机构
[1] Natl Res Council Canada, Inst Informat Technol, Ottawa, ON K1A 0R6, Canada
基金
美国国家卫生研究院;
关键词
ethics; empirical studies; software engineering; legal issues;
D O I
10.1109/TSE.2002.1158289
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
The popularity of empirical methods in software engineering research is on the rise. Surveys, experiments, metrics, case studies, and field studies are examples of empirical methods used to investigate both software engineering processes and products. The increased application of empirical methods has also brought about an increase in discussions about adapting these methods to the peculiarities of software engineering. In contrast, the ethical issues raised by empirical methods have received little, if any, attention in the software engineering literature. This article is intended to introduce the ethical issues raised by empirical research to the software engineering research community and to stimulate discussion of how best to deal with these ethical issues. Through a review of the ethical codes of several fields that commonly employ humans and artifacts as research subjects, we have identified major ethical issues relevant to empirical studies of software engineering. These issues are illustrated with real empirical studies of software engineering.
引用
收藏
页码:1171 / 1180
页数:10
相关论文
共 50 条
  • [1] Use of Personality Tests in Empirical Software Engineering Studies A Review of Ethical Issues
    Usman, Muhammad
    Minhas, Nasir Mehmood
    [J]. PROCEEDINGS OF EASE 2019 - EVALUATION AND ASSESSMENT IN SOFTWARE ENGINEERING, 2019, : 237 - 242
  • [2] Ethical issues in empirical software engineering: The limits of policy
    Andrews A.A.
    Pradhan A.S.
    [J]. Empirical Software Engineering, 2001, 6 (02) : 105 - 110
  • [3] Issues in using students in empirical studies in software engineering education
    Carver, J
    Jaccheri, L
    Morasca, S
    Shull, F
    [J]. NINTH INTERNATIONAL SOFTWARE METRICS SYMPOSIUM, PROCEEDINGS, 2003, : 239 - 249
  • [4] Issues in applying empirical software engineering to software architecture
    Falessi, Davide
    Kruchten, Philippe
    Cantone, Giovanni
    [J]. SOFTWARE ARCHITECTURE, PROCEEDINGS, 2007, 4758 : 257 - +
  • [5] Professional Issues in Software Engineering curricula: Case studies on ethical decision making
    Georgiadou, E
    Oriogun, PK
    [J]. INTERNATIONAL SYMPOSIUM ON TECHNOLOGY AND SOCIETY, PROCEEDINGS, 2001, : 252 - 261
  • [6] Empirical studies of software engineering
    Petre, M
    [J]. INTERNATIONAL JOURNAL OF HUMAN-COMPUTER STUDIES, 2004, 61 (02) : 165 - 167
  • [7] Ethics and Empirical Studies of Software Engineering
    Janice Singer
    Norman Vinson
    [J]. Empirical Software Engineering, 2000, 5 (2) : 89 - 91
  • [8] The limits of empirical studies of software engineering
    Parnas, DL
    [J]. 2003 INTERNATIONAL SYMPOSIUM ON EMPIRICAL SOFTWARE ENGINEERING, PROCEEDINGS, 2003, : 2 - 5
  • [9] Trust Issues in Crowdsourced Software Engineering: An Empirical Study
    Khan, Huma Hayat
    Malik, Muhammad Noman
    Alotaibi, Youseef
    [J]. JOURNAL OF INFORMATION SCIENCE AND ENGINEERING, 2022, 38 (04) : 715 - 733
  • [10] Ethical issues in software engineering research: A survey of current practice
    Hall T.
    Flynn V.
    [J]. Empirical Software Engineering, 2001, 6 (4) : 305 - 317